/** \details
This definition represents an individual segment along the IfcAlignment2DVertical, being defined in the distance-along/z coordinate space.
The vertical alignment is defined by segments that connects end-to-start.
The vertical alignment curve geometry is defined in a plane with x = distance along horizontal, the y = height (or elevation).
The transition at the segment connection is not enforced to be tangential,
if the “tangential continuity” flag is set to false, otherwise a tangential continuity shall be preserved.
The following vertical segment types are defined:
* line segment - IfcAlignment2DVerSegLine
* circular arc segment - IfcAlignment2DVerSegCircularArc
* parabolic arc segment - IfcAlignment2DVerSegParabolicArc which can describe symmetric and asymmetric parabolas
*/

/** \details
Returns the value of StartGradient attribute.
This attribute represents the gradient of the tangent of the vertical segment at the start point.
It is provided as a ratio measure. The ratio is percentage/100 (0.1 is equal to 10%).
It has a theoretical range of -∞ < n < ∞ using a ratio measure.
The equivalent range measured in degree is -90° < n < 90°.
Positive gradient means an increasing height at the start (or uphill),
a negative gradient means decreasing height at the start (or downhill).
\returns
Returns the value of StartGradient attribute.
*/
double getStartGradient() const;
